Basic / Breeders Info
Cereal Killer is a mostly indica variety from Cabin Fever and can be cultivated indoors (where the plants will need a flowering time of ±65 days) and outdoors. Cabin Fevers Cereal Killer is a THC dominant variety and is/was never available as feminized seeds.
Cabin Fevers Cereal Killer Description
This is a very funky, chunky Bubba-esque hybrid I decided to create. The male was a great specimen of Chocolate Chunk/Bubba Kush from Mountain Genetics. The females were from a pack of seeds marked "Tom Hills Deep Chunk x Pre-98 Bubba Kush". They were gorgeous even in pre-flower.
The male I chose was a bit taller than his brothers, and since the females were very short and stout, I was hoping that the male would add a little height, The result is a medium sized plant that is nutrient and stress tolerant. Some will get very colorful, turning from a rich, dark green to a burgundy and almost black. the ones that start showing frost and color earliest are the ones I prefer, and were also the ones I used for this hybrid. This plant is very stout, with strong stem and branches, great internodal spacing and medium yield of top shelf meds. It is a healthy eater and its vigorous growth cycle means more watering. It can take between 60 and 70 days to mature and will produce an extremely aromatic sweet coffee type smell, even in its vegetative period.
